Output 123a035642c03360a18c53b9a9f9f2f8967900c5afdf88b4df5844c4ad4f9baa:1

value
1053661
script pubkey
OP_0 OP_PUSHBYTES_20 8c964619e6b34d93ae276ff658e3e14b967a0758
address
bc1q3jtyvx0xkdxe8t38dlm93clpfwt85p6c6772va
transaction
123a035642c03360a18c53b9a9f9f2f8967900c5afdf88b4df5844c4ad4f9baa
spent
true